Una estrella és cobdiciosa?
Una estrella és cobdiciosa?

Vídeo: Una estrella és cobdiciosa?

Vídeo: Una estrella és cobdiciosa?
Vídeo: CHILA JATUN - Justicia para Vivir (Video Clip Oficial) HD 2024, Maig
Anonim

A* (A estrella ) A* és una combinació de Dijkstra i Avariciós . Utilitza la distància des del node arrel més la distància heurística fins a l'objectiu. L'algorisme s'acaba quan trobem el node objectiu.

A més, s'ha completat la millor primera cerca de greedy?

En resum, avariciós BFS no ho és completa , no òptim , té una complexitat temporal de O(bm) i una complexitat espacial que pot ser polinomi. A* és completa , òptim , i té una complexitat temporal i espacial de O(bm). Així, en general, A* utilitza més memòria que avariciós BFS. A* es fa poc pràctic quan el cerca l'espai és enorme.

A més amunt, és admissible un *? Si la funció heurística és admissible , el que significa que mai sobreestima el cost real per arribar a l'objectiu, A* es garanteix que retornarà un camí de menor cost des del principi fins a l'objectiu. El valor f de l'objectiu és llavors el cost del camí més curt, ja que h a l'objectiu és zero en an admissible heurístic.

A més, per què és millor un * que la millor primera cerca?

A* aconsegueix millor rendiment mitjançant l'ús d'heurístiques per guiar-lo cerca . A* combina els avantatges de El millor - primera cerca i Cost uniforme Cerca : assegureu-vos de trobar el camí optimitzat alhora que augmenta l'eficiència de l'algorisme mitjançant heurístiques.

ÉS un algorisme * complet?

A* és completa i sempre trobarà una solució si n'hi ha. Fes una ullada a l'article de la viquipèdia. Si més enllà l'heurística és admissible i monòtona el algorisme també serà admissible (és a dir, òptim).

Recomanat: